Output 21e8ea71196f6552d76353dec15b5d208561cb98aba24cbbb5b27d626cb3b994:0

value
63210
script pubkey
OP_0 OP_PUSHBYTES_20 ec5309a125221df72f32a9746b201888dbaa3874
address
bc1qa3fsngf9ygwlwtej496xkgqc3rd65wr5gw7xca
transaction
21e8ea71196f6552d76353dec15b5d208561cb98aba24cbbb5b27d626cb3b994
spent
true